Cowberry (Brusnika)

Vaccinium vitis-idaea is a small evergreen shrub in the heath family, Ericaceae. It is known colloquially as the lingonberry, partridgeberry, foxberry, mountain cranberry, or cowberry. It is native to the boreal forest and Arctic tundra throughout the Northern Hemisphere.

Interactions & contraindications

May affect immune activity

Watch for: Immunosuppressants (for transplant or autoimmune conditions)

Immune-stimulating herbs can work against immunosuppressive therapy.

May affect blood sugar

Watch for: Insulin and oral diabetes medications (metformin, sulfonylureas)

Additive blood-sugar-lowering effects can risk hypoglycemia — monitor glucose closely.

May have a diuretic effect

Watch for: Diuretic medications and lithium

Additive fluid loss can affect electrolyte balance and change how the body clears lithium.
